Output 61d8faa1078ac4012ce681045544b0a4e28b3d86c03625af16f559487b10832e:1

value
68513292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a399016f1b94de3db75e3d34b9a325d6632c091 OP_EQUALVERIFY OP_CHECKSIG
address
1GX4q9bFcm877WCcerPHWEMvhMYPJZ98oT
transaction
61d8faa1078ac4012ce681045544b0a4e28b3d86c03625af16f559487b10832e
spent
true